the fog lites are going to be aimed low, and their reflectors will be for close up pattern. And they probably dont have any adjustment. As if you wanted them to throw out farther and higher up, you would have to rebuild the whole fixture to get them to project any differently

Default 997.1 Fog Light adjustability

Ref previous comments, there is a torx screw on the back of the fog light/indicator housing. Screwed it in and out but couldn’t see any difference with it moving in my hand. Was 10PM so didn’t take time to do the whole before and after thing illuminating my garage door.

Anyone know about this “adjusting screw.” Based on it’s orientation, might be left/right adjustment that would make sense for changing beam for left/right hand drive cars.

Also, had the housing out to put in a small CANBUS bulb for running lights. Fog light halogen is marked H8, not H11. What’s ground truth on that as I want to do LED Fogs. Think I’ve decided that retrofit to better performing bulbs (LED) is the way to go vs. whole new LED housings. I think stock looks better and want to avoid the whole 997.2 wannabe thing. Car is a 997.1 GT3.
